How many airports are there in Maryland?

There are 3 airports in Maryland. The busiest airport is Baltimore/Washington Airport (BWI), with 98% of all flights arriving there.

How long is the flight to Maryland?

An average direct flight from New Zealand to Maryland takes 28h 29m, covering a distance of 22771 km. The shortest route is Auckland (AKL) to Washington, D.C. Reagan-National Airport (DCA) with an average flight time of 18h 25m.

What are the most popular destinations in Maryland?

Based on KAYAK flight searches, the most popular destination is Washington, D.C. (77% of total searches to Maryland). The next most popular destination is Philadelphia (23%).

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from New Zealand to Maryland?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ly from New Zealand to Maryland with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from New Zealand to Maryland?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ying from New Zealand to Maryland up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.
